And it seems to me that the seven deadly sins, though not directly stated in the Bible, are alluded to and can be taken from the Bible. Greed is wrong because you are to love and help the poor, your neighbor. If you are greedy, and suck in all the money and keep it all to yourself, you're not exactly helping the poor. Most of the rest of the deadly sins are the same sort of thing; Wrath isn't loving your neighbor/enemy, Envy gets in the way of loving your neighbor, Gluttony is about the same as Greed, Pride is loving yourself more then your neighbor, Lust... Well, Lust gets in the way of properly loving your neighbor.
